
Senior Software Development Engineer (AWS Connect) - R01554288
- Saint Louis, MO
- Permanent
- Full-time
- AWS Connect, Software Developer, Backend: NodeJS
- AWS Development: Senior Software Development Engineer
- We are seeking a skilled and motivated AWS Connect Engineer to join our cloud engineering team.
- The ideal candidate will have hands-on experience designing and implementing scalable, secure, and high-performance solutions using Amazon Connect, Node.js, AWS Lambda, API Gateway, and event-driven architectures.
- You will play a key role in building intelligent contact center solutions and integrating them with enterprise systems.
- Design, develop, and maintain solutions using Amazon Connect for voice and chat-based customer interactions.
- Build and deploy serverless applications using AWS Lambda, API Gateway, and Node.js.
- Integrate Amazon Connect with backend systems and third-party APIs.
- Implement event streaming and real-time data processing using Amazon Kinesis, Kafka, or EventBridge.
- Develop and manage contact flows, Transfer Queues, Lex bots, and Lambda integrations within Amazon Connect.
- Ensure solutions are secure, scalable, and compliant with industry standards.
- Collaborate with cross-functional teams including DevOps, QA, and Product to deliver high-quality solutions.
- Monitor and troubleshoot production issues, ensuring high availability and performance.
- 5-8 years of experience in software engineering with a focus on cloud-native applications.
- Strong hands-on experience with Amazon Connect, including contact flows, routing profiles, and integrations.
- Proficiency in Node.js and experience building RESTful APIs.
- Experience with AWS Lambda, API Gateway, DynamoDB, S3, CloudWatch, and IAM.
- Familiarity with event-driven architectures and tools like Amazon EventBridge, Kinesis, or Kafka.
- Understanding of CI/CD pipelines, infrastructure as code (e.g., CloudFormation, Terraform), and DevOps practices.
- Excellent problem-solving skills and ability to work in a fast-paced, agile environment.
- AWS Certification (e.g., AWS Certified Developer - Associate, AWS Certified Solutions Architect).
- Experience with Amazon Lex, Polly, or other AI/ML services in the AWS ecosystem.
- Background in contact center technologies or customer experience platforms.
- Knowledge of security best practices and compliance frameworks (e.g., HIPAA, PCI).